Renowned for its Chinese language courses, Beijing Language and Culture was founded in 1962. The Chinese name of the university is Yuyan Xueyuan. The university also accounts for teaching different foreign languages to their native students. It offers various bachelor’s, and master’s degree programs and doctoral courses. It comprises of various faculties of foreign languages. Wei-Heng Chen, Valerie Grosvenor Myer (Literary Historian), Laing Xiao Sheng (Screenwriter and Novelist) are notable faculty members of the university.
Currently, it is home to more than 8,812 students enrolled in various language courses offered by the university. The university is nicknamed as Bei Yu and its main campus is situated in Haidian which is a district in Beijing. It is the only language learning institute in China. The university comprises of around 1,211 academic staff members out of which around 600 are teaching staff and others are administrative staff. The campus has special dorms known as “Little United Nations” provided for international students.
